Article 1: “Don’t mess around with skin care! What is the skin care regimen that top models must follow every day?”

Men now “take skincare for granted. It is now considered etiquette to keep one’s skin in good shape. Mr. Pierre is no exception, as he takes care of his skin every day. So we asked Pierre to tell us about his skincare philosophy.

Mr. Pierre
In modeling, the condition of one’s skin directly affects how creative one’s work will turn out, so I make skincare a part of my daily routine. Of course, it is also a way to improve myself. Specifically, I use oil and milky lotion after taking a bath before going to bed at night. There is a huge difference in the tone of my skin the next day when I do this or don’t do this. These are just two basic skin care products, but it is important to build a solid base for your skin without trying to do too many things. Nowadays, it is common for men as well as women to take care of their skin, and if you want to improve the appearance of your skin in an easy-to-understand way, you should definitely take care of your skin!

The key is choosing the right items. Pierre’s style is to stick to organic and actively incorporate new things!

Pierre says that skincare is an essential piece of a man’s game. He is particular about the items he chooses.

Mr. Pierre
I always research new skincare items and actively try out the ones I am interested in. Her sources of information are SNS and word-of-mouth from family and friends. I don’t stick to specific brands or men’s products, but check a wide range of products, including unisex and women’s products, and choose what I like. And the point I am most particular about is that the ingredients are organic. The purpose of skin care is to care for the skin, but additives can damage it, so it is a must to choose additive-free organic products, not only for oils and milky lotions, but also for shampoos and body soaps.

Article 3: “Controlling one’s diet is another way to improve one’s manhood. Is it a sign of a good man that he cares about what he eats?”

In addition to skin care and clothing as discussed in Articles 1 and 2, another important factor in raising a man is to create a well-rounded body by controlling his diet. Mr. Pierre is very careful about such daily eating habits.

Mr. Pierre
Of course, skin care and fashion are the most important things to look good. But I also take care of my inner body on a daily basis. That means controlling my diet well. Specifically, I do fasting every day. I eat dinner at 8:00 p.m. and have my next meal at 2:00 p.m. the next day. By skipping breakfast, I leave 18 hours between dinner and lunch. Of course, there are times when the time shifts due to work, but basically I take a late lunch after my daily training routine around 12:00 to 13:00 noon. This not only helps me to lose weight, but also improves my immune system and helps me to lead a healthy life.

Article 4: “A man’s backside looks great with his legs and hip line! By training your legs and hips on a regular basis, you can make your body “look good” in clothes.”

Choosing clothes with good taste and eating well are important, but maintaining one’s body shape is essential to make clothes look cool. In addition to training his body with muscle training, Pierre says that he also does exercises that are different from other models to build his body.

Mr. Pierre
There are two types of male models. There are two types of male models: the masculine, stocky types like myself, and the slender, feminine types. The latter type rarely work out because it is not necessary to make their bodies bigger, but the former type needs to exercise and train every day without fail to build their bodies. This is where I have adopted Muay Thai. No matter how busy I am, I try to go to the Muay Thai gym four times a week, and if I have time, I go five or six times a week. The reason I started Muay Thai was when I went to Thailand on business. There was a Muay Thai camp next to the hotel where I stayed, and when I tried it there, I was hooked. I have always loved martial arts and even did Tae Kwon Do when I was younger, but Muay Thai is the most fun for me now. Sometimes I can’t make it to the gym, so of course I make sure to do push-ups, squats, and other weight training at home.

It is not simply a matter of training the body, but it is also important to focus on the points where the clothes look good. Pierre trains “that part” of his body through Muay Thai.

Mr. Pierre
It is also important to train the key areas that make clothes look cool. For example, arms and legs are the most important points. Arms and legs are trained well when you do Muay Thai. Also, by doing Muay Thai, your hip line will naturally tighten up. I myself do not train the hip line consciously, and if anything, it is an area that female models are particularly concerned about, but I think it is just as important for men as it is for legs in terms of making the silhouette of pants look good. In addition, we also rearrange the areas to be worked out depending on the season. For example, in spring and summer, I sometimes take off my tops, so I focus on my waist so that my abdominal muscles can be broken.
